The diamond in the rough
The diamond in the rough

This is the home we started with. A modern home with a lot of potential that had not been updated for a long time.


Entry courtyard
Entry courtyard

The design included removing the thin section of roof at the front of the entry courtyard. (on the right of picture above)


Updated exterior lighting
Updated exterior lighting

Another change was replacing the white windows with black units and replacing the front door. (it will be painted black) The lighting at the front door was updated for a modern look.



Updated front door
Updated front door

We also added glass to the wall behind the front door so the view when you enter is of the wooded property beyond.


View to backyard from the Entry Courtyard
View to backyard from the Entry Courtyard

Updated garage door
Updated garage door

The garage door went from solid white to a sleek glass model with black trim, the soffit from painted white to a stained cedar.


View from the street
View from the street

We also changed the color of the home from a red to a blue/gray. We also used stained cedar around the front door to add some warmth to the front elevation. The retaining wall was replaced and moved to create additional space at the front entry with a modern concrete look.
